﻿@CHARSET "UTF-8";

/*
**  Maslak Tasarım ve İnternet Hizmetleri
**  http://www.maslaktasarim.com
**  bilgi@maslaktasarim.com
**
*/

body, html 
{ 
	margin:0px;
}
img {border:0px;}
body
{
    background: #5fb2e6;
    font-family: Verdana, Tahoma, Arial, Helvetica, sans-serif;
    font-size:14px;
    }

#genel 
{
    width: 1081px;
    margin:0px auto;
    background: url(ust-arka.jpg) no-repeat;
    min-height: 600px;
    }

#ust 
{
    height: 114px;
    padding-left: 182px;
    
    }
    
#orta 
{
    width:697px;
    margin-left:182px;
    min-height: 457px;
    background: #fff;
    padding-left:10px;
    padding-right:10px;
    text-align:justify;
    }
    
#alt 
{
    background: url(alt-arka.jpg) no-repeat;
    background-position: -1px 0px;
    height: 200px;
    padding-top:60px;
    text-align:center;
    font-size: 12px;
    color: #2275a9;
    }
    
.slogan 
{
    color: #2275a9;
    font-family: Arial;
    font-size: 16px;
    line-height: 19px;
    padding: 20px;
    }

.alttablo {padding:0px 20px 30px 20px;
     color: #2275a9;
    font-family: Arial;
    font-size: 15px;
    background: url(paypay.jpg) no-repeat;
    background-position: 30px bottom;}

.urunlist {padding:60px 10px 10px 40px; text-align:left;}
.urunlist a 
{
    font-family: Arial;
    font-size:15px;
    font-weight: bold;
    text-decoration:none;
    color:#fff;
    line-height: 20px;
    }
.urunlist a:hover {text-decoration:underline;}

.urunlist2 {padding:10px 10px 10px 40px; text-align:left; font-family: Arial;
    font-size:15px;
    font-weight: bold;
    text-decoration:none;
    color:#2275a9;
    line-height: 20px;
    }
.urunlist2 a 
{
    font-family: Arial;
    font-size:15px;
    font-weight: bold;
    text-decoration:none;
    color:#2275a9;
    line-height: 20px;
    }
.urunlist2 a:hover {text-decoration:underline;}

.basbas2 
{
    font-size:15px;
    font-weight: bold;
    text-decoration:none;
    color:#2275a9;
    line-height: 24px;
    margin-bottom: 10px;
    padding-left: 20px;
    border-left: solid 5px #1e6fa1;
    }
#atlas 
{
    width: 319px;
    height: 295px;
    background: url(atlas.jpg) no-repeat;
    float: left;
}

#dimeda 
{
    width: 319px;
    height: 295px;
    background: url(dimeda.jpg) no-repeat;
    margin-left: 340px;
    }
    
#gvz 
{
    width: 659px;
    height: 111px;
    background: url(gvz.jpg) no-repeat;
    margin-top: 10px;
    }

.gvzyazi 
{
    font-family: Arial;
    font-size:16px;
    text-decoration:none;
    color:#fff;
    line-height: 18px;
    padding: 32px 20px 10px 100px;
    }
.gvzyazi a{text-decoration:none; color:#fff;}
.gvzyazi a:hover{text-decoration:underline;}
#menu 
{
    width: 520px;
    position:relative;
    left: 350px;
    top:60px;
    }

#dileng
{
    background: url(eng.jpg) no-repeat;
    width: 125px;
    height: 19px;
    position:relative;
    left: 610px;
    top:10px;
    }
    
#dileng a 
{
    padding-left: 40px;
    font-family: Arial;
    font-size:13px;
    text-decoration:none;
    color:#fff;
    }
#dileng a:hover { text-decoration:underline;} 

#diltr
{
    background: url(tr.jpg) no-repeat;
    width: 125px;
    height: 19px;
    position:relative;
    left: 610px;
    top:10px;
    }
    
#diltr a 
{
    padding-left: 40px;
    font-family: Arial;
    font-size:13px;
    text-decoration:none;
    color:#fff;
    }
#diltr a:hover { text-decoration:underline;} 

.mmtr{float:left;}  
.mmtr a
{
    font-family: Arial;
    font-size:15px;
    font-weight: bold;
    padding: 5px 10px 5px 10px;
    text-decoration:none;
    color:#fff;
    }
    
 .mmtrs{float:left;}  
.mmtrs a
{
    font-family: Arial;
    font-size:15px;
    font-weight: bold;
    padding: 5px 10px 5px 10px;
    text-decoration:none;
    color:#1e6fa1;
    }
 
.mmtr a:hover
{   
        color:#1e6fa1;
    }
    
.yazyaz 
{
    color: #2275a9;
    font-family: Arial;
    font-size: 15px;
    line-height: 19px;
    padding: 20px;
    
    }
    
.basbas 
{
    color: #1e6fa1;
    font-family: Arial;
    font-size: 18px;
    font-weight: bold;
    line-height: 24px;
    margin-bottom: 10px;
    padding-left: 20px;
    border-left: solid 5px #1e6fa1;
    }
    
span {text-align:left; font-size:4px;}
#map {width: 650px; height: 320px;}
#aloalo 
{
    position:relative;
    top: -35px;
    width: 650px;
    height: 35px;
    background: #fff;
    
    }

#intr 
{
    margin:0px auto;
    width: 717px;
    height: 440px;
    background: url(intro.jpg) no-repeat;
    font-size: 15px;
    font-weight:bold;
    color: #fff;
    }

#intr a 
{
    font-family: Arial;
    font-size:15px;
    font-weight: bold;
    padding: 5px 10px 5px 10px;
    text-decoration:none;
    color:#1e6fa1;
    border-bottom:solid 3px #1e6fa1;
    }

#intr a:hover {border-bottom:solid 3px #fff;}

#trk {float:left; text-align: right;}
#engl {margin-left:250px; border-left:solid 3px #1e6fa1; padding-left:50px; height: 100px;}
#yer {position:relative; top: 300px; padding-left: 100px;}

#pro #proa {display:none;}
#pro:hover #proa {display:block;}

#menu ul {
list-style: none;
margin: 0;
padding: 0;
float: left;
}

#menu a
{
    font-family: Arial;
    font-size:15px;
    font-weight: bold;
    padding: 5px 10px 5px 10px;
    text-decoration:none;
    color:#fff;
    display: block;
    }
    
#menu a:hover
{   
        color:#1e6fa1;
    }

#menu li {position: relative; float:left;}


#menu ul ul {
position: absolute;
z-index: 500;
}

div#menu ul ul {display: none;}

div#menu ul li:hover ul {display: block; width: 240px; background: #71bbe8;}
.abc:hover {background: #71bbe8; }
.paypay {float:left; width:220px;}

.treeview, .treeview ul { 
	padding: 0;
	margin: 0;
	list-style: none;
}

.treeview ul {
	/*background-color: white;*/
	margin-top: 4px;
}

.treeview span {font-size:15px;}

.treeview .hitarea {
	background: url(treeview-default.gif) -64px -25px no-repeat;
	height: 16px;
	width: 16px;
	margin-left: -16px;
	float: left;
	cursor: pointer;
}
/* fix for IE6 */
* html .hitarea {
	display: inline;
	float:none;
}

.treeview li { 
	margin: 0;
	padding: 3px 0pt 3px 16px;
}

.treeview a.selected {
	/*background-color: #eee;*/
}

#treecontrol { margin: 1em 0; display: none; }

.treeview .hover { color: red; cursor: pointer; }

.treeview li { background: url(treeview-default-line.gif) 0 0 no-repeat; }
.treeview li.collapsable, .treeview li.expandable { background-position: 0 -176px; }

.treeview .expandable-hitarea { background-position: -80px -3px; }

.treeview li.last { background-position: 0 -1766px }
.treeview li.lastCollapsable, .treeview li.lastExpandable { background-image: url(treeview-default.gif); }  
.treeview li.lastCollapsable { background-position: 0 -111px }
.treeview li.lastExpandable { background-position: -32px -67px }

.treeview div.lastCollapsable-hitarea, .treeview div.lastExpandable-hitarea { background-position: 0; }
